Systems engineering is a complex discipline that involves integrating various components to create a functional system. Mistakes in this field can lead to project delays, increased costs, and system failures. Understanding common errors and strategies to avoid them is essential for successful project execution.
Common Mistakes in Systems Engineering
One frequent mistake is inadequate requirements analysis. Failing to gather comprehensive and clear requirements can result in design flaws and scope creep. Another common error is poor communication among stakeholders, which can cause misunderstandings and misaligned expectations.
Lessons from Real-World Projects
Real-world projects highlight the importance of thorough planning and stakeholder engagement. Projects that involve early validation and verification tend to identify issues sooner, reducing costly rework. Additionally, maintaining detailed documentation helps ensure consistency and clarity throughout the project lifecycle.
Strategies to Avoid Common Mistakes
- Conduct comprehensive requirements analysis to understand all stakeholder needs.
- Establish clear communication channels among team members and stakeholders.
- Implement iterative testing and validation throughout the development process.
- Maintain detailed documentation to track decisions and changes.
- Foster a collaborative team environment to encourage feedback and continuous improvement.
